Put pen to paper with Romeo + Jules…

Scalloped edges, vibrant stripes, playful squiggles and multi-coloured leopard prints are just some of the hand-drawn designs adorning the stationery at Romeo + Jules, created by former luxury magazine Art Director, Jennifer Grant.

The notecards, menus, placecards and writing paper – all of which can be customised – were created by the self-made entrepreneur who discovered a gap in the market after the birth of her second child.

“I went searching for a certain aesthetic of stationery and when it couldn’t be found, I made my own,” she reveals. “The business grew slowly as I created notecards and invitations for friends. Little by little, I realised there was a need for modern stationery.”

Jennifer’s energetic and colourful patterns lend an artisan feel to the range. “We are brave in both our design decisions and our love of patterns and we want to bring that aesthetic to Dubai,” says the mum-of-two who has recently opened a studio in the UAE. Along with offering an abundance of beautiful stationery, the multidisciplinary creative studio also offers branding and art direction.

In a world of WhatsApps, DMs and emails, we long to put pen to paper, especially when it’s decorated with seashells and stripes. romeoandjules.studio
